8. Textured Stripes for Depth

Textured striped wallpaper adds a subtle yet impactful element to your living room. Whether vertical or horizontal, stripes can create the illusion of height or width, making them ideal for various room layouts. Textured stripes also introduce an extra layer of visual interest, making them perfect for modern and contemporary spaces.
To maximize the effects of striped wallpaper, use vertical stripes in low-ceiling rooms to create an illusion of height. Pair them with solid furniture to keep the overall design balanced. Choose complementary colors to maintain a cohesive look throughout the space.
Consider these strategies for using striped wallpaper:
– Opt for vertical stripes to enhance ceiling height.
– Pair with solid-colored furniture for balance.
– Use complementary colors for a unified look.

How To Choose Eco-Friendly Wallpaper for Your Living Room
Choosing the right eco-friendly wallpaper for your living room can enhance your decor while supporting sustainability. Here are some key criteria to consider when picking out the best wallpaper.
1. Material
Look for wallpapers made from natural or recycled materials. Options include paper, bamboo, and textiles that are free from harmful chemicals. Remember that materials like vinyl are not eco-friendly, so check labels carefully. Sustainable choices not only help the environment but also add a unique texture to your space.
2. Design Style
Pick a design that aligns with your living room’s overall theme. Modern wallpaper designs can offer a fresh, contemporary look, while vintage floral prints add character and warmth. Consider how the wallpaper will complement your existing decor and choose patterns that resonate with your style.
3. Eco-Certifications
Look for eco-certifications like FSC (Forest Stewardship Council) or Greenguard. These certifications ensure that the wallpaper meets strict environmental standards. Choosing certified products helps ensure that your wallpaper is made responsibly and contributes to a healthier indoor environment.
4. Color Combinations
Select wallpaper color combinations that enhance the mood you want to create. Soft pastels can bring a calming effect, while bold colors can energize the room. Think about how the colors interact with your furniture and lighting to create a cohesive look.
5. Texture
Consider textured wallpaper options if you want to add depth and interest to your living room. Textured wallpaper can create a tactile experience and make your walls feel more dynamic. Look for options like grasscloth or fabric finishes that can also provide sound absorption.
6. Budget
Set a budget before you start shopping. Eco-friendly wallpaper can vary in price, so know your limits. Don’t forget to factor in additional costs like adhesive and installation. You can find stylish options at various price points, so prioritize quality and design within your budget.
Pro Tip: Always order a sample before committing to a full roll. Seeing the wallpaper in your space will help you assess how it interacts with light and your existing decor. It’s a small step that can save you time and money in the long run!

Frequently Asked Questions
What are eco-friendly wallpaper options for a living room, and how do I pick the best one?
Eco-friendly wallpaper options for a living room include recycled-paper wallpapers, natural-fiber textures like grasscloth or hemp, bamboo, and cork, plus PVC-free or vinyl-free choices. Look for certifications such as FSC-certified paper and inks/adhesives that are VOC-free or low-VOC. Check that the backing is recyclable and that the product provides durable washability for living room use. For wallpaper in living room ideas, choose materials that feel warm, comfortable, and resilient to daily wear. For modern wallpaper designs, consider clean geometric patterns or botanical prints in a restrained color palette to stay trend-forward but timeless. Practical steps: 1) define your budget and durability needs; 2) order large swatches and test in your living room light; 3) compare adhesives and installation methods; 4) confirm warranty and disposal options. Choosing eco-friendly wallpaper helps reduce toxins and improve indoor air quality over time.

What are accent wall ideas using wallpaper that suit small living rooms?
Accent walls can add depth in a small living room by drawing the eye to one area. Choose light, airy colors and opt for matte or soft finishes; use vertical stripes or a small-scale textured wallpaper options to give the illusion of height. Keep surrounding walls in a lighter shade to balance. If you’re renting, consider removable peel-and-stick wallpaper options. For wallpaper color combinations, pick hues that echo your furniture and art for a cohesive look. Always test swatches on the actual wall under daylight and lamp light before committing.

How to install and maintain eco-friendly wallpaper in living room ideas?
Prep the wall with a clean, dry surface and prime if needed. Choose an adhesive suitable for eco-friendly wallpaper (often water-based, low-VOC). Align and join patterns carefully, trimming edges with a sharp knife. For maintenance, dust regularly and wipe with a damp cloth if the wallpaper is washable; avoid harsh cleaners. When it’s time to remove, use the proper adhesive remover or opt for removable options like peel-and-stick wallpapers for easier upgrades.
